Benefits of Remote Work
1. Reduced Business Costs
Remote work helps companies save money on office rent, utilities, and equipment.
2. Access to Global Talent
Businesses can hire skilled professionals from different countries without geographical limitations.
3. Improved Employee Satisfaction
Flexible work arrangements often lead to better work-life balance and increased job satisfaction.
4. Higher Productivity
Many employees perform better in a comfortable environment with fewer workplace distractions.
Effective Remote Work Strategies
Use Collaboration Tools
Platforms like Zoom, Microsoft Teams, Slack, and Google Workspace help teams communicate effectively.
Set Clear Goals
Employees should understand their responsibilities and deadlines clearly.
Regular Team Meetings
Weekly meetings help keep everyone aligned with business objectives.
Encourage Work-Life Balance
Companies should support healthy schedules to prevent employee burnout.
Provide Cybersecurity Training
Remote workers must understand how to protect company data and avoid security threats.
